The book "Satan's Invisible World Discovered" was authored by Scottish preacher and academic George Sinclair. The inquiry in the book looks at the alleged presence of witches, devils, and other paranormal beings in 17th-century Scotland. Sinclair bases his assertions regarding the presence of witches and demons in Scotland on a mix of biblical texts, historical documents, and first-hand testimonies. He gives instances of purported witchcraft trials and executions and goes into great depth on the various means by which witches are said to harm others, such as spells and curses. The book also explores the theology that underpins evil's existence and Satan's place in the universe. Sinclair contends that the presence of witches and demons is evidence of Satan's power and that a steadfast Christian faith is necessary to fight it.
